My check engine light came on last night and the car started missing a
little at low rpm. Advance put it on the computer and it said cylinder
#4 was misfiring. Replaced plugs, no difference. He said the other
possibilities would be either wires or a bad #4 fuel injector. Does this
sound right? Is replacing a fuel injector a difficult and/or expensive
thing? Thanks for any impute.
